Provide technical assistance to the development and deployment of a GNSS ear tag to feral cattle in Northern Australia.
We offer an exciting opportunity for an eResearch Hardware Technician ($65,650- $74,462) to join our world-leading institution at James Cook University (JCU). A full time, fixed term appointment to 30 April 2023, this position is based at the JCU Bebegu Yumba campus in Townsville.
What you can accomplish in the Role
As part of the successful “Improved feral cattle and buffalo herd management for environmental and economic benefits in remote Northern Australia” project , this newly created position offers an exciting opportunity to provide technical assistance in the development of a Global Navigation Satellite System ear tag to be deployed to feral cattle in Northern Australia.
What you will bring to the Role
With an aptitude for electrical engineering and a demonstrated competence and knowledge of satellite telemetry and an understanding of GNSS systems, you will perform laboratory and field testing of an ear tag hardware platform. You will demonstrate effective communications skills as you work collaboratively with project partners to ensure research objectives are met within required timeframes.
